run-test.sh 429 B

123456789101112131415161718192021222324
  1. #!/bin/sh
  2. rm -f ./env-record
  3. ../../dinit -d sd -u -p socket -q \
  4. -e environment1 \
  5. checkenv
  6. ../../dinit -d sd -u -p socket -q \
  7. -e environment2 \
  8. checkenv
  9. ../../dinit -d sd -u -p socket -q \
  10. setenv1
  11. STATUS=FAIL
  12. if [ -e env-record ]; then
  13. if [ "$(cat env-record)" = "$(echo hello; echo goodbye; echo 3; echo 2; echo 1)" ]; then
  14. STATUS=PASS
  15. fi
  16. fi
  17. if [ $STATUS = PASS ]; then exit 0; fi
  18. exit 1